Transaction 20ab46ec7de59d6436a71662c440cd7520140df3298310113d64f7dd346a8cd0
1 Input
2 Outputs
- 20ab46ec7de59d6436a71662c440cd7520140df3298310113d64f7dd346a8cd0:0
- 20ab46ec7de59d6436a71662c440cd7520140df3298310113d64f7dd346a8cd0:1
value 779316
address 34YEDRrdNRcB1hQpVvz1JGKHBK1CTQ6sTG
value 1988990
address 18kG95bZVabsPkXyBBvMh43UPivyFZThxg